Types of Windows

Before diving into the repair procedure, it is necessary to understand the different kinds of windows. Each type has its distinct repair requirements.

Window TypeDescriptionCommon Issues
Single-HungFeatures a fixed upper sash and a movable lower sash.Broken glass, damaged tracks
Double-HungBoth sashes are movable.Glass problems, malfunctioning locks
SashHinged at the side and opens external.Broken hinges, fracture in structure
SlidingOperates by sliding along tracks.Off-track problems, broken glass
BayA combination of windows that extends outside.Frame damage, glass seal failure

Understanding Causes of Window Breakage

Window damage can happen for numerous reasons, consisting of:

  1. Accidents: Unintentional effect from items, such as balls or tree branches.
  2. Weather: Extreme weather condition, like hail or high winds, can cause damage.
  3. Wear and Tear: Over time, aging and absence of upkeep can result in weakened glass.
  4. Theft Attempt: Burglars may break a window throughout a break-in.

Identifying the reason for breakage can assist property owners take preventive measures in the future.

Actions for Broken Window Repair

Fixing a broken window includes several key actions. House owners might choose to manage minor repairs themselves or work with experts for extensive damage. Here's a guide laying out the procedure:

1. Evaluating the Damage

  • Examine the Window: Determine if the damage is restricted to the glass or if the frame is likewise damaged.
  • Security First: Wear gloves and goggles to protect versus sharp pieces of glass.

2. Preparing for Repair

  • Gather Materials: Depending on the type of rep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k window, you might need:
    • Replacement glass or a window film
    • Glazing putty or caulk
    • An utility knife
    • A glass cutter (for DIY repairs)
    • Screwdriver
    • Clean fabrics
  • Remove the Broken Glass: Carefully extract the shattered pieces. Use a putty knife to eliminate any old glazing.

3. Determining and Cutting

  • Step the Frame: Obtain accurate dimensions of the window frame for purchasing replacement glass.
  • Cut Glass: If doing a DIY repair, utilize a glass cutter to cut the new piece to size.

4. Setting up Replacement

  • Fit Replacement: Place the replacement glass into the frame.
  • Use Glazing: Use glazing putty to secure the glass, or make use of a window tape if appropriate.
  • Smooth and Seal: Ensure that the seal is even to avoid air or water leaks.

5. Tidy up

  • Dispose of Broken Glass: Use care in safely dealing with any broken pieces.
  • Final Touches: Clean the frame and surrounding location for a refined appearance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can I repair a window myself?

A1: Yes, small repairs, such as replacing a shattered glass pane, can often be done by property owners with the right tools and materials. Nevertheless, for significant damage or uncertainty, looking for a professional is suggested.

Q2: What is the cost of window repair?

A2: The cost varies based upon factors like location, window type, and the degree of the damage. Typically, a requirement window repair normally ranges from ₤ 200 to ₤ 500.

Q3: How long does the repair take?

A3: Minor repairs can typically be finished within a few hours. More comprehensive damage might need a full day, particularly if the window structure requires restoring.

Q4: How can I prevent future window breakage?

A4: Regular maintenance is essential. Guarantee that trees/shrubs are cut, set up window guards if essential, and pick window types suited to your environment.

Maintenance Tips for Windows

Maintaining windows can minimize repair needs. Here are some helpful practices:

  • Regular Cleaning: Use proper glass cleaners to keep presence.
  • Seal Inspection: Check for damaged seals and repair them immediately to prevent moisture accumulation.
  • Lubrication: Regularly oil hinges and moving systems to prevent functional issues.
  • Weatherstripping: Install or replace weatherstripping to ensure energy efficiency.
